For many outdoor enthusiasts, hunting small game is a popular activity that provides a fun and challenging way to connect with nature. One of the most enjoyable and practical forms of small game hunting is shooting squirrels with a pellet gun. This activity is not only a great way to hone your hunting skills, but it also offers a chance to enjoy the outdoors and appreciate the beauty of nature.
The main purpose of shooting squirrels with a pellet gun is to provide a source of food and to control pest populations. For many people, squirrel hunting is a way to supplement their food supply and enjoy a fresh, organic meal. Additionally, shooting squirrels can help to protect gardens and crops from damage caused by these pesky critters.
There are several types of pellet guns that can be used for squirrel hunting, including spring-powered and CO2-powered models. These guns are relatively affordable and easy to use, making them a great option for beginners. Some common variations of pellet guns include break-barrel and semi-automatic models.
To get started with shooting squirrels with a pellet gun, it's essential to choose the right equipment. Look for a gun that is powerful enough to humanely take down a squirrel, and make sure to practice your aim before heading out into the field. It's also important to follow all local laws and regulations regarding hunting and firearms.

Here are a few actionable tips to help you make the most of your squirrel hunting experience: start early in the morning when squirrels are most active, use the right ammunition, and be patient and quiet while waiting for your shot. With a little practice and patience, you can enjoy a fun and rewarding day of squirrel hunting with your pellet gun.
